Problem description:  bullets and numbering/ outline  list /  numeric and all
sub-levels numbering does not work. It is not setup properly in the options
tab.

Further:-
The numeric and all sub-levels selection can be set up correctly in the options
tab. However this does not become permanent or global either within the
document being editted or across documents as these new settings will only
apply to the one list currently being formatted within that document.

Current behavior:
Does not show all levels, 
On pressing the Tab button against a list line it just indents and does not
show all levels, it just displays level 1. 

Expected behavior:
On pressing the tab button against a list line it should indent and display the
new sub-level. 

I have tried using tools/ outline numbering but this appears to be just for
headings or is best used for only that purpose. At one pont I lost all the
heading outline numbering in the document and it only returned when I
re-instated the outline numbering against headings.
